如何在VPS上快速搭建高效网站?步骤详解
卡尔云官网
www.kaeryun.com
随着互联网的快速发展,越来越多的人开始选择在虚拟专有服务器(VPS)上搭建自己的网站,VPS是一种经济实惠的 hosting解决方案,相比独立服务器成本低,相比共享服务器性能高,如果你是第一次接触VPS,或者想在VPS上搭建网站,那么这篇文章将帮助你一步步掌握从零到一的搭建过程。
选择合适的VPS服务商
选择一家可靠的VPS服务商是成功搭建网站的第一步,好的服务商提供稳定、可靠的服务器环境,同时价格亲民,售后服务好,常见的VPS服务商有AWS、DigitalOcean、HostGator、GoDaddy等,根据你的预算和需求,选择适合的服务商,美国地区的服务商(如AWS、DigitalOcean)稳定性更高,而亚洲地区的服务商(如HostGator)成本更低。
注册域名和购买SSL
搭建网站需要一个域名(domain name)和一个安全的证书(SSL),域名是你网站的“名字”,可以方便别人找到你的网站,你的网站是example.com,那么别人就可以直接访问http://example.com,购买域名和SSL是必不可少的步骤。
注册域名需要选择一个易于记忆且朗朗上口的域名,www.example.com比example.com更有意义,购买SSL可以确保你的网站在HTTPS模式下运行,这样可以提升网站的安全性和可信度。
安装操作系统
安装操作系统是搭建网站的必要步骤,大多数VPS服务商会提供Debian或Ubuntu等开源的操作系统,安装完成后,你可能需要进行一些基本的配置,比如启用Web服务器(Apache、Nginx等)、安装PHP、安装MySQL等数据库。
安装过程中,可能会遇到一些问题,比如文件权限设置不正确、服务无法启动等,这时候,你需要查阅文档,或者寻求社区的帮助,逐步解决这些问题。
搭建网站
搭建网站是整个过程的核心部分,你需要选择一个合适的Web服务器软件(如Apache、Nginx),安装必要的插件(如HTML、CSS、JavaScript等),然后开始编写你的网站代码,你可以使用任何你熟悉的语言编写网站,比如HTML、CSS、JavaScript等。
如果你有一定的编程经验,可以选择使用Content Management System(CMS)如WordPress、Drupal等,这些系统可以帮助你快速搭建一个专业的网站,对于新手来说,使用CMS可能更容易上手。
优化和测试
搭建网站后,还需要进行优化和测试,优化包括代码优化、代码审计、安全测试等,代码优化可以提高网站的加载速度,代码审计可以发现潜在的安全漏洞,安全测试可以确保网站在各种攻击下都能正常运行。
测试阶段,你可以使用一些工具,Burp Suite、SiteLock 等,来测试网站的安全性,如果发现漏洞,及时修复,可以避免潜在的网络安全风险。
部署和维护
部署是将你的网站迁移到VPS上,完成部署后,你需要进行日常维护,维护包括备份数据、监控网站运行状态、定期更新软件等,备份数据可以防止数据丢失,监控网站运行状态可以及时发现并解决问题,软件更新可以确保你的网站始终运行在最新版本。
在VPS上搭建网站虽然有一定的复杂性,但只要按照步骤一步步来,就可以顺利完成,选择合适的VPS服务商、注册域名和购买SSL、安装操作系统、搭建网站、优化和测试、部署和维护,这些步骤可以帮助你成功建立一个高效、安全的网站,注意网站的优化和维护,可以让你的网站吸引更多流量,提升搜索引擎排名。
卡尔云官网
www.kaeryun.com